What are PSTS Post Secondary Survey candidate records?
• The student must have the proper exit category or completion status last year.
• Completion status in CALPADS needs to be:
o 100, 120, 250, 320, 330, or 360.
• Or the exit category in CALPADS needs to be:
o E125, E140, E230, E300, E400, E410, T260, T270, T280, T310, T370 orT380
• Otherwise we can’t send the PSTS survey results as CALPADS won't recognize the record as needing them.
We can find the groups of PSTS records by going to Predefined Queries
Click on Search, Click on Predefined Queries
Open the Data Monitoring tab
- PSTS data required/blank: This is your to-do list to get down to zero. Eligible but no answer filled in yet.
- PSTS data - all eligible: This is all possible records needing the survey filled out regardless if answer filled out.
- PSTS successfully reported: These are the records that have already been reported to CALPADS.
We can find 'all eligible' PSTS records and go to a list that shows all the survey information entered in so far.
Go to /Reporting/Student Lists/Predefined lists
Open the Data Monitoring tab, look for the Post-Secondary list button.
Here we want to make sure we have contact information filled out so we can do labels for mailing or minimally phone/email for phone or email survey questions.
The list contains, student name, school attending, contact name, contact address, contact email, contact phone, primary post secondary status answer, secondary post secondary status.
